Creating an organizational culture to underpin organizational strategy

I quote from an article by Ernst & Young (or EY as they are nowadays called) from their Performance portal

“Culture goes beyond capturing the minds of employees, but captures their values, their beliefs, their hearts. It is ultimately what drives behavior. And that behavior needs to support the strategic objectives of the firm, in order to result in business success.”

The article explores how EY Africa set about uniting its 33 separate country units in an ambitious undertaking. Each unit had its own cultures, languages and operations. The need to create an organizational culture to support the company’s strategic objectives was quickly apparent.
